Defra Wood Stoves

If you live in a smoke-free zone then you will require a DEFRA approved wood stove. These stoves emit very little smoke and provide plenty of light, heat and flames.

Leading manufacturers like Arada, Parkray and Stovax have developed a selection of traditional Defra stoves which come with the latest technology for clean burning. These stoves can burn a variety fuels including smokeless coal.

Efficient Combustion

The wood stoves from Defra utilize the latest technology for combustion to ensure clean and efficient burning. They do this by ensuring that the fire is not being depleted of oxygen. This means that any part-burned burning combustibles which aren't completely burned will not escape down the chimney and into the air, where they could create pollution.

These Defra-approved wood stoves are more suitable for your chimney system and flue because they generate less smoke. This helps keep them clean longer, cut down on costs for maintenance and DEFRA Stoves Reviews increase the performance of your wood stove.

Additionally, Defra wood stoves are ideal for those who live in UK Smoke Control Areas. This is because they allow you to burn smokeless fuels and wood without violating the law. You can select from a range of sizes and heat outputs that will fit your home.

It's important to remember that only DEFRA legislation stoves approved stoves are to be used in smoke-controlled areas as they have been approved to burn authorised fuels and wood. You may be penalized if you burn fuels that are not approved by the Defra in your Defra-approved stove.

Reduced Emissions

A large portion of the Defra wood stoves we offer have been certified to be ecodesign ready'. This means that they have been approved by the EU to be as efficient and as clean burning possible. The Ecodesign regulations have higher standards for efficiency and emissions than government's "clearSkies" scheme.

The primary benefit of the Defra approved stove is that it will produce much less smoke than a non-certified stove. The reason is that they are built to ensure constant flow of air into the fire. This is achieved by having a secondary and sometimes even a tertiary air intake. This prevents the stove from being depriving of air during the combustion process and thus reduces the amount of black smoke it produces.

Modern stoves also produce less harmful particles than older models. This is important as particulate matter can get into the bloodstream and circulate through the body, eventually settling in the lungs and the heart. This could cause serious health problems and even premature death.

Despite the fact that these stoves produce far less harmful pollutants than older models and emit less harmful pollutants, the EU still wants to reduce pollution from all sources. It has been associated with asthma and other respiratory problems.

The government has published an Environment Plan draft to help to meet the new air quality targets. The plan aims to reduce average PM 2.5 concentrations in the UK to 10 micrograms per cubic metre by 2040. This will require the reduction of household fuel emissions, including wood stoves.
